PRCA Americas launch inaugural US PR Census

The inaugural PRCA U.S. Census in collaboration with the USC Annenberg Center for Public Relations and PRWeek is now live. The world’s largest professional PR association is asking all PR and communications professionals to spare 10 minutes of their time to complete the survey. Responses will help paint the most accurate picture of what the industry looks like right now, including who is in the industry, what they do, what their working hours are, and how much they earn. European Communication Monitor 2022 survey launched: The largest international poll on communications trends

The European Public Relations Education and Research Association (EUPRERA) has launched its annual poll on the status and future of strategic communication and PR. Communication professionals across Europe are invited to participate in the survey, which is available here until March 12. The European Communication Monitor, now in its 16th year, addresses highly debated topics such as the practical challenges of diversity and inclusion in stakeholder communications, empathetic leadership in communications teams, CommTech and digital transformation, and quality in communications consulting. PRCA Race & Ethnicity Equity Board appoints Emmanuel Ofosu-Appiah as Vice Chair

Emmanuel Ofosu-Appiah has today been appointed Vice Chair of the PRCA’s Race and Ethnicity Equity Board (REEB). Emmanuel joined REEB in January 2021 and currently leads the ethnic men in PR and social mobility work stream. He is a leading voice on the topic of diversity and inclusion in PR and is passionate about creating long-term change to ensure diverse talent can thrive within public relations.
